@fractalhedge @tradesace Nasa has the best UFO evidence. Use to have a live station here in FL and cut if off from mass sighting live on TV

@fractalhedge @tradesace Nasa has the best UFO evidence. Use to have a live station here in FL and cut if off from mass sighting live on TV